Charleworthii x lawrenceanum also seems to be called P. Decipiens

What on Earth is going on?
 
Old hybrids, 1900's record keeping on paper, renaming of species, mistakes, using natural hybrids as species names and then changing your mind... Pick any three or four, there are lots of ways to get there and all have been done at least once. :)
 
Charlesworthii x lawrenceanum also seems to be called P. Decipiens

I've seen a plant labelled P. Decipiens for sale in the states.

If Decipiens and Penelope are both names for a primary cross from charlesworthii and lawrenceanum, is a plant purchased as Decipiens able to be called Penelope? Are they different or simply different names for the same thing?

If no one knows does anyone know where I might find out?
 
Contact A & P Orchids: https://www.facebook.com/AP-Orchids-478555548842210/ Their Penelope was only registered in 2019 and should look good (Paphiopedilum Vale of Churchill × Paphiopedilum Hsinying Charles). I think the Decipiens name takes priority for that cross so charlesworthii and lawrenceanum technically isn't Penelope. RHS accepts Penelope for the A & P cross.
